Quick facts
- Capital: Lucknow
- Largest city: Kanpur
- Language: Hindi (widely spoken), with Urdu also commonly used in many areas.
- Best time to visit: October to March, when the weather is cooler and more comfortable.
Must-visit destinations
- Agra – Famous for the Taj Mahal, Agra Fort, and nearby Fatehpur Sikri.
- Varanasi (Kashi) – One of the world's oldest continuously inhabited cities, known for the Ganga Aarti, Kashi Vishwanath Temple, and riverfront ghats.
- Lucknow – The City of Nawabs, celebrated for its architecture, cuisine, and cultural heritage.
- Ayodhya – Revered as the birthplace of Lord Rama and home to the Ram Mandir.
- Prayagraj – Known for the Triveni Sangam and the Kumbh Mela.
- Mathura & Vrindavan – Sacred towns associated with the life of Lord Krishna.
Things to do
- Watch the evening Ganga Aarti in Varanasi.
- Visit the Taj Mahal at sunrise.
- Explore Mughal and Nawabi architecture.
- Experience festivals like Diwali in Ayodhya and Holi in Mathura and Vrindavan.
- Enjoy boat rides on the Ganges in Varanasi.
